/ohos5.0/docs/zh-cn/application-dev/reference/apis-camera-kit/ |
H A D | _camera___output_capability.md | 22 | [Camera_Profile](_camera___profile.md) \*\* [photoProfiles](#photoprofiles) | 拍照配置文件列表。 | 42 ### photoProfiles subsection 45 Camera_Profile** Camera_OutputCapability::photoProfiles
|
/ohos5.0/foundation/multimedia/camera_framework/frameworks/native/ndk/impl/ |
H A D | camera_manager_impl.cpp | 274 GetSupportedPhotoProfiles(outCapability, photoProfiles); in GetSupportedCameraOutputCapability() 310 std::vector<Profile> &photoProfiles) in GetSupportedPhotoProfiles() argument 312 if (photoProfiles.size() == 0) { in GetSupportedPhotoProfiles() 314 outCapability->photoProfiles = nullptr; in GetSupportedPhotoProfiles() 317 outCapability->photoProfilesSize = photoProfiles.size(); in GetSupportedPhotoProfiles() 318 outCapability->photoProfiles = new Camera_Profile* [photoProfiles.size()]; in GetSupportedPhotoProfiles() 320 for (size_t index = 0; index < photoProfiles.size(); index++) { in GetSupportedPhotoProfiles() 328 outCapability->photoProfiles[index] = outPhotoProfile; in GetSupportedPhotoProfiles() 412 GetSupportedPhotoProfiles(outCapability, photoProfiles); in GetSupportedCameraOutputCapabilityWithSceneMode() 431 if (cameraOutputCapability->photoProfiles != nullptr) { in DeleteSupportedCameraOutputCapability() [all …]
|
H A D | camera_manager_impl.h | 106 std::vector<OHOS::CameraStandard::Profile> &photoProfiles);
|
/ohos5.0/foundation/multimedia/camera_framework/frameworks/native/camera/src/output/ |
H A D | camera_output_capability.cpp | 153 bool CameraOutputCapability::IsMatchPhotoProfiles(std::vector<Profile>& photoProfiles) in IsMatchPhotoProfiles() argument 155 CHECK_ERROR_RETURN_RET(photoProfiles.empty(), true); in IsMatchPhotoProfiles() 157 for (auto& profile : photoProfiles) { in IsMatchPhotoProfiles() 225 void CameraOutputCapability::SetPhotoProfiles(std::vector<Profile> photoProfiles) in SetPhotoProfiles() argument 227 photoProfiles_ = photoProfiles; in SetPhotoProfiles()
|
/ohos5.0/docs/en/application-dev/reference/apis-camera-kit/ |
H A D | _camera___output_capability.md | 22 | [Camera_Profile](_camera___profile.md) \*\* [photoProfiles](#photoprofiles) | Double pointer to t… 43 ### photoProfiles subsection 46 Camera_Profile** Camera_OutputCapability::photoProfiles
|
/ohos5.0/foundation/multimedia/camera_framework/frameworks/js/camera_napi/src/ |
H A D | camera_napi_object_types.cpp | 132 auto photoProfiles = Hold<std::list<CameraNapiObject>>(); in GetCameraNapiObject() local 135 …photoProfiles->emplace_back(std::move(Hold<CameraNapiObjProfile>(profile)->GetCameraNapiObject())); in GetCameraNapiObject() 158 { "photoProfiles", photoProfiles }, in GetCameraNapiObject()
|
/ohos5.0/docs/zh-cn/application-dev/media/camera/ |
H A D | camera-moving-photo.md | 30 …reference/apis-camera-kit/js-apis-camera.md#cameraoutputcapability)类中的photoProfiles属性,可获取当前设备支持的拍照… 35 let photoProfilesArray: Array<camera.Profile> = cameraOutputCapability.photoProfiles;
|
H A D | camera-deferred-photo.md | 33 …reference/apis-camera-kit/js-apis-camera.md#cameraoutputcapability)类中的photoProfiles属性,可获取当前设备支持的拍照… 38 let photoProfilesArray: Array<camera.Profile> = cameraOutputCapability.photoProfiles;
|
H A D | camera-device-input.md | 82 //photoProfiles属性为获取当前设备支持的拍照输出流 83 let photoProfilesArray: Array<camera.Profile> = cameraOutputCapability.photoProfiles;
|
H A D | camera-deferred-capture.md | 34 …reference/apis-camera-kit/js-apis-camera.md#cameraoutputcapability)类中的photoProfiles属性,可获取当前设备支持的拍照… 39 let photoProfilesArray: Array<camera.Profile> = cameraOutputCapability.photoProfiles;
|
H A D | camera-shooting.md | 21 …reference/apis-camera-kit/js-apis-camera.md#cameraoutputcapability)类中的photoProfiles属性,可获取当前设备支持的拍照… 25 let photoProfilesArray: Array<camera.Profile> = cameraOutputCapability.photoProfiles;
|
H A D | native-camera-device-input.md | 129 photoProfile = cameraOutputCapability->photoProfiles[0];
|
/ohos5.0/foundation/multimedia/camera_framework/frameworks/native/camera/src/session/ |
H A D | photo_session.cpp | 224 auto photoProfiles = photoProfilesIt->second; in IsPhotoProfileLegal() local 225 return std::any_of(photoProfiles.begin(), photoProfiles.end(), [&photoProfile](auto& profile) { in IsPhotoProfileLegal()
|
H A D | video_session.cpp | 230 auto photoProfiles = photoProfilesIt->second; in IsPhotoProfileLegal() local 231 return std::any_of(photoProfiles.begin(), photoProfiles.end(), [&photoProfile](auto& profile) { in IsPhotoProfileLegal()
|
/ohos5.0/foundation/multimedia/camera_framework/interfaces/inner_api/native/camera/include/output/ |
H A D | camera_output_capability.h | 196 void SetPhotoProfiles(std::vector<Profile> photoProfiles); 257 bool IsMatchPhotoProfiles(std::vector<Profile>& photoProfiles);
|
/ohos5.0/foundation/distributedhardware/distributed_camera/services/cameraservice/cameraoperator/handler/src/ |
H A D | dcamera_handler.cpp | 234 std::vector<CameraStandard::Profile> photoProfiles = capability->GetPhotoProfiles(); in CreateDHItem() local 235 ConfigFormatphoto(SNAPSHOT_FRAME, root, photoProfiles); in CreateDHItem() 253 std::vector<CameraStandard::Profile> photoProfiles = capability->GetPhotoProfiles(); in CreateDHItem() local 254 ConfigFormatphoto(SNAPSHOT_FRAME, modeData, photoProfiles); in CreateDHItem()
|
/ohos5.0/foundation/multimedia/camera_framework/frameworks/js/camera_napi/demo/entry/src/main/ets/model/ |
H A D | CameraService.ts | 236 let photoProfiles: Array<camera.Profile> = profiles.photoProfiles; 241 if (isValidProfiles && (!photoProfiles || photoProfiles.length < 1)) { 263 photoProfileObj = photoProfiles.find((profile: camera.Profile) => { 277 photoProfileObj = photoProfiles.find((profile: camera.Profile) => { 312 photoProfileObj = photoProfiles.find((profile: camera.Profile) => { 340 for (let index = profiles.photoProfiles.length - 1; index >= 0; index--) { 341 const photoProfile = profiles.photoProfiles[index]; 2032 let photoProfiles: Array<camera.Profile> = coc.photoProfiles; 2033 …Logger.info(TAG_AB, `getCameraOutputCapabilities photoProfiles: ${JSON.stringify(photoProfiles)}`);
|
/ohos5.0/foundation/multimedia/camera_framework/interfaces/inner_api/native/test/ |
H A D | camera_capture_mode.cpp | 368 std::vector<Profile> photoProfiles = {}; in main() local 393 photoProfiles = outputcapability->GetPhotoProfiles(); in main() 395 for (auto i : photoProfiles) { in main() 423 for (auto it : photoProfiles) { in main()
|
H A D | camera_capture.cpp | 164 std::vector<Profile> photoProfiles = outputcapability->GetPhotoProfiles(); in main() local 165 for (auto i : photoProfiles) { in main()
|
/ohos5.0/docs/en/application-dev/media/camera/ |
H A D | camera-device-input.md | 82 // photoProfiles is the photo output streams supported by the current camera device. 83 let photoProfilesArray: Array<camera.Profile> = cameraOutputCapability.photoProfiles;
|
H A D | camera-moving-photo.md | 30 …You can use the **photoProfiles** attribute of the [CameraOutputCapability](../../reference/apis-c… 35 let photoProfilesArray: Array<camera.Profile> = cameraOutputCapability.photoProfiles;
|
H A D | camera-deferred-photo.md | 33 …You can use the **photoProfiles** attribute of the [CameraOutputCapability](../../reference/apis-c… 38 let photoProfilesArray: Array<camera.Profile> = cameraOutputCapability.photoProfiles;
|
/ohos5.0/foundation/multimedia/camera_framework/interfaces/kits/native/include/camera/ |
H A D | camera.h | 679 Camera_Profile** photoProfiles; member
|
/ohos5.0/foundation/multimedia/camera_framework/frameworks/native/camera/src/input/ |
H A D | camera_manager.cpp | 1379 if (profilesWrapper.photoProfiles.empty() && profilesWrapper.previewProfiles.empty() && in GetFallbackConfigMode() 1512 profilesWrapper.photoProfiles.push_back(profile); in ParseBasicCapability() 1670 profilesWrapper.photoProfiles.push_back(snapProfile); in CreateProfileLevel4StreamType() 1734 FillSupportPhotoFormats(profilesWrapper.photoProfiles); in GetSupportedOutputCapability() 1736 cameraOutputCapability->SetPhotoProfiles(profilesWrapper.photoProfiles); in GetSupportedOutputCapability() 1737 MEDIA_INFO_LOG("SetPhotoProfiles size = %{public}zu", profilesWrapper.photoProfiles.size()); in GetSupportedOutputCapability() 1862 profilesWrapper.photoProfiles.push_back(snapProfile); in CreateProfile4StreamType() 2290 void CameraManager::FillSupportPhotoFormats(std::vector<Profile>& photoProfiles) in FillSupportPhotoFormats() argument 2292 if (photoFormats_.size() == 0 || photoProfiles.size() == 0) { in FillSupportPhotoFormats() 2297 for (const auto& profile : photoProfiles) { in FillSupportPhotoFormats() [all …]
|
/ohos5.0/foundation/multimedia/camera_framework/frameworks/native/camera/test/moduletest/include/ |
H A D | camera_framework_moduletest.h | 75 std::vector<Profile> photoProfiles; variable
|